Eastern North Pacific Tropical Weather Outlook

2021-10-18 19:20:37| National Hurricane Center (East Pacific)

000 ABPZ20 KNHC 181720 TWOEP Tropical Weather Outlook NWS National Hurricane Center Miami FL 1100 AM PDT Mon Oct 18 2021 For the eastern North Pacific...east of 140 degrees west longitude: A broad area of low pressure is expected to form in a few days a couple of hundred miles south of the coast of southern Mexico. Environmental conditions are expected to be conducive to support some development thereafter, and a tropical depression could form late this week or this weekend while the system moves west-northwestward to northwestward near or just south of the coast of southern Mexico. * Formation chance through 48 hours...low...near 0 percent. * Formation chance through 5 days...medium...40 percent. $$ Forecaster Brown
